- Description: This set of Dongo Likembe is a copy of similar sets used further west by the Soga. These in turn they say were copied from others in the West Nile province. The music is popular amongst young people. Many people they say have gone to stay in Buganda because of Matoke (bananas) from which banana beer is made. 'Bananas have attracted our people.' Dance song with seven Dongo Likembe and clapping.

- Description: Poor, beautiful, young Arigina died before she could be married. Death, they say, is no respector of persons it comes to young and old alike. An interesting example of the crossed rhythms between the instruments and voices. Lament with seben Dongo Likembe, clapping and rattles.

- Description: A clever use of the lower and upper octaves in the pipe. The lower follows the higher. The player blows across the square end of the open pipe. Topical song with Auleru vertical flute, open, four notes.
